The annual Resource Management Law Association (RMLA) awards were presented on the closing night of the RMLA annual conference. The awards were:

RMLA Publication Award 2017: Beca, Southern Skies and Auckland Council won the award for articulating the best current knowledge and practice in erosion and sediment control.

RMLA Outstanding Person Award 2017: Adam Wild, for making an outstanding contribution to the field of heritage and conservation architecture, both in New Zealand and internationally.

RMLA Documentation Award 2017: Sea Change Tai Timu Tai Pari Hauraki Gulf Marine Spatial Plan for its excellence in executing a collaborative process and producing an innovative plan to protect a nationally significant taonga.

RMLA Project Award 2017: Waikato Regional Council for its forward-looking approach to resolving freshwater quality and allocation issues.

Principal Judge RJ Bollard Lifetime Commemorative Award: The Hon Peter Salmon CNZM QC, one of RMLA's founders and its inaugural President for dedicating a lifetime of leadership to the resource management sector.
